Stereoselective Synthesis of Densely Substituted Pyrrolidines via a [3 + 2] Cycloaddition Reaction between Chiral N - tert -Butanesulfinylazadienes and Azomethine Ylides.

Ester Blanco-LópezFrancisco FoubeloMaría de Gracia RetamosaJosé Miguel Sansano
Published in: Organic letters (2023)
The N - tert -butanesulfinylimine group behaves as a suitable electron-withdrawing group in 1-azadienes, allowing the diastereoselective synthesis of densely substituted pyrrolidines by 1,3-dipolar cycloadditions (1,3-DCs) with azomethylene ylides. The use of Ag 2 CO 3 as catalyst has allowed one to obtain a wide variety of proline derivatives with high regio- and diastereoselectivities. Subsequent efficient transformations provide valuable proline derivatives, some of which can be used as organocatalysts. The influence of the N - tert -butanesulfinyl group on the diastereoselectivity was studied by computational methods.
